Busy H&A reveals swathe of new licensed lines

Kendra Dandy, The Powerpuff Girls and Krispy Kreme among new licences.

Licensed toiletries specialist H&A has unveiled a raft of new lines, starring a varied range of licences from Beauty and the Beast through to Krispy Kreme.

The busy company has welcomed a new Beauty and the Beast collection, with the Chip Cup Bath Fizzer launching exclusively in Boots. The range also includes Cogsworth Bubble Bath, which is available exclusively at Primark.

Staying with character and entertainment brands, a new Spider-man bathing range includes the Web Head Hair Set (including a detangle brush, Spider-man stickers and a fruity styling gel), as well as Spidey Bath Bubbles.

The range for The Powerpuff Girls, meanwhile, has launched exclusively at Boots and features a selection of beauty products. These include Bath Colour Puffs and the Super Power Nail Set, which features three nail polishes (Blossom Pink, Bubbles Blue and Buttercup Green), a nail file and a sheet of themed nail stickers.

Moving more into the brand space, and H&A has teamed with artist Kendra Dandy for a Bouffants & Broken Hearts cosmetics, accessories and bath range.

Products include the Freshen Up collection (including body lotion, mini mist spray and watermelon bath confetti), a cosmetic bag and Match Your Matte, which is a coral coloured lip and nail kit.

Finally, H&A is adding a twist to the Krispy Kreme brand with the launch of cosmetics and accessories.

Products include a Krispy Kreme Lip Glaze set and a nail set.
